2005 Hyundai Tucson vs. 2010 Nissan Altima
To start off, 2010 Nissan Altima is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Hyundai Tucson.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Hyundai Tucson would be higher. At 2,500 cc (4 cylinders), 2010 Nissan Altima is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2010 Nissan Altima (175 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 36 more horse power than 2005 Hyundai Tucson. (139 HP @ 5800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2010 Nissan Altima should accelerate faster than 2005 Hyundai Tucson.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Hyundai Tucson weights approximately 72 kg more than 2010 Nissan Altima.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2010 Nissan Altima (244 Nm) has 63 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Hyundai Tucson. (181 Nm). This means 2010 Nissan Altima will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Hyundai Tucson.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Hyundai Tucson | 2010 Nissan Altima | |
Make | Hyundai | Nissan |
Model | Tucson | Altima |
Year Released | 2005 | 2010 |
Body Type | SUV |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1966 cc | 2500 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 139 HP | 175 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 181 Nm | 244 Nm |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1470 kg | 1398 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4330 mm | 4595 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1800 mm | 1796 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1690 mm | 1420 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2620 mm | 2675 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 8.7 L/100km | 7.6 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 10.7 L/100km | 10.2 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 58 L | 76 L |
